Piceatannol, isolated from the roots of
Rheum undulatum, prevented oxygen radical formation and inhibited lipid peroxidation; the effective concentrations were 25

M for a radical scavenging assay and 2.1

M for a microsome assay. Using cDNA microarray analysis to determine which genes were modulated by piceatannol, 33 genes were up-regulated while 157 genes were down-regulated in the human gastric cancer cell line.
